Calnor Dale is being reluctantly pushed into a decades-long intrigue planned by the disOrder of Adjustment. He wants no part of it, or any other reminders of his past. Instead, he wants to settle into a quiet life, and make new friends.But in the face of injustice, a quiet life is a complicit life: he has to help his new friends where he can. When his careful, reasonable plans go wrong and his court-mandated corrective implant is removed out of spite, Calnor's past self, Joreth, regains control.Joreth is neither careful nor reasonable.
